Thursday, December 01, 2011. 12 Days of Christmas. 3/4 pound unsalted butter, at room temperature. 1 cup sugar, plus extra for sprinkling. 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ract. 3 1/2 cups all-purpose flour. 6 to 7 ounces very good semisweet chocolate, very finely chopped.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. You can also just cut them in circle shapes or just leave plain sprinkled with colored sugar sprinkles or just plain. Make them your very own. This recipe makes about 3 dozen.
